Wine Tasting Challenge

For Wine Connoisseurs and Beginners alike!

How good are your taste buds?

Do you know your Merlot from your Malbec, your Chardonnay from your Chenin Blanc?

Join in with friends to test yourself and maybe even find a new favourite tipple!

£20 gets you 5 tasting wines and a cold supper (+soft drinks if you’re a designated driver or just need to refresh your palate)

You can join as teams of six and all proceeds go to our President’s charity, Hearing Dogs, which supports deaf people.

Venue: Harpenden Trust Hall, Southdown Road, Harpenden

Date: Saturday 8 October

Time: 7.30pm

US$60,000 scholarship for post-graduate study

There is currently an amazing opportunity being offered by Rotary District 1260 (Beds, Bucks and Herts) and District 1130 (London).

Each Rotary club in these two districts can put forward one applicant to apply for a grant of up to US$60,000 for a postgraduate student to study in Melbourne, Australia, in 2026.

Lions score again

Harpenden Lions Club chalked up a 12th victory at this year’s Harpenden Quiz of Quizzes, staged by Rotary in Harpenden at St George’s School. The runners-up were Odds and Ends.

As well as giving quizzers a stimulating evening, the event has become noted for its interval hot suppers, produced by the renowned Godfrey’s and served at the quizzers’ tables.

For Shoebox read Friendship Box

Just a few of the many photos we have received from Rotarians in Lviv, a major city in west Ukraine, where our first Friendship Boxes, filled with educational and recreational items, were delivered in time for Christmas to children most affected by the war.
